What does eLearning look like in the HDSB?
HDSB eLearning is a Regional program that students register through myBlueprint or through Student Services at their homeschool. The HDSB eLearning program offers asynchronous, fully online classes. Teachers, students and lesson resources are accessible for the duration of their eLearning courses.

Here is what eLearning has to offer you:
- earn the same secondary school credits in a different manner
- develop 21st century eLearning skills
- learn at flexible times and places
- access courses that may not be offered in your secondary school
- Prepare students for post-secondary
- continue to earn secondary school credits even if you are physically absent from your school for extended periods of time
